Lieselotte Wera Saueressig's Obituary
Lieselotte "Lilo" Saueressig Lilo Saueressig passed away peacefully on March 4, 2008. She was 87 years old. Born in Leipzig, Germany on January 18, 1921, Lilo spent her young adult years as a student of the Academy of Arts and Technology in Hanau, Germany. She earned a Masters in Goldsmith and Jewelry design. She came to America after World War II and started a family. Lilo was a widow. She is survived by a son, Perry Saueressig of Lacey WA, and two daughters, Esme Sasser of Portland, OR and Cora Lewis of Tacoma, WA. Lilo had six grand-daughters and three great grand-daughters. She is also survived by two sisters, nieces and nephews, and many friends, some of which were life-long, some newer, but all special to her.
